Asian Games 2023: India bag bronze in 25m rapid fire pistol team event

Vijayveer Sidhu finished fourth in the individual event.
India have started off Day 2 of the Asian Games 2023 on a brilliant note with medals coming in from shooting and rowing just like the first day of the competition. India bagged their third bronze in shooting, thanks to the trio of Vijayveer Sidhu, Anish Bhanwala, and Adarsh Singh in the 25m rapid fire pistol event.
The Indian shooters had a mixed beginning to the event, with Vijayveer and Adarsh scoring less than 290 of the total 300 points up for grabs in the first stage. But Anish, who represented India at the previous Asian Games in Jakarta compensated by scoring 292, which includes two shots of 98. India were expected to raise their game in the second stage, to which Vijayveer responded with scores of 99 and 98.
He ended up with 293 points in the second stage and a total of 582 helped him qualify for the Individual finals. Adarsh was also up to the task as he improved his scoring 289 in the second stage to put India in the reckoning for the silver medal. But, Anish couldn't match his first-stage scoring, as his scores dropped drastically from 292 to 268 in the second stage.
The dip in scores not only sent India out of the race for the silver medal but almost made them lose the bronze as well. Indonesia were trailing behind India by 11 points at one point and the low scores resulted in squandering the lead. Both India and Indonesia finished with 1718 and will share the bronze medal.
Hosts China grabbed the gold with 1765 points, which includes a qualification games record tally of 590/600 by the 34-year-old Li Yuehong. The Republic of Korea showed how good they are in consistency and precision, as they won the silver with 1734 points.
